Obligation: nf (word coming from the legal Latin obligatio, from obligare, from ligare, to bind).
The word “obligation” has several meanings:
1. Right: Legal relationship by virtue of which a person can be forced to give, to do or not to do something (creditor, debtor).
Maintenance obligation. (Latin in solidum "to the whole")
Obligation "in solidum", which binds several persons vis-à-vis one or more others.
Specially: Debt created by a legal bond.
